A Crazy Game

Football never ceases to amaze us all I’m sure.

Never has a case been so pronounced than today at Gosport where us “Crows” grabbed all 3 points at the very end in a match where not many of our lads came out with much credit but the all important points were taken.

We started initially very well and could and should have been 1 or 2-0 up. Bad finishing. Several other opportunities went begging, then as with this crazy game. Gosport had one chance and we found ourselves 1-0 down!

We got ourselves back on level terms reasonably quickly. Some good work by Sam Ives and Josh Castiglione made it 1-1.

After that it seemed we could go on to get 3 points but yet again football being football an incident that I didn’t see but have no complaints over, saw Sam Corcoran sent off with 5 mins of the first half still to play!!

We got the lads in and reorganised the formation.

Second half and we went ahead by a set play finished off by Dan Brathwaite. To hold on and get the win would be a great achievement although our opposition weren’t the best.

They equalised with a superb strike that Joe had no chance of stopping.

The odds were that a draw was the most likely outcome but our resilience that we often showed last year come to the fore and Ryan Ingrey was on hand to snatch the 3 points that we were ecstatic on getting.

To reflect, 6 points from 9 is a good start in a league higher but to get it and not really perform like these talented lads can is hopefully a good sign.

A free week to train twice before our next match. Organisation and hard work is the emphasis to keep ourselves in the top half!!
